What Is Cold Exposure?

Cold exposure generally refers to intentionally exposing the body to cold temperatures through one of several methods:

  • Cold showers
  • Ice baths or cold plunges (typically 50–59°F / 10–15°C)
  • Cold-water swimming
  • Whole-body cryotherapy chambers (-166°F to -220°F / -110°C to -140°C for 2–3 minutes)
  • The Wim Hof Method, which combines:
    • Controlled breathing
    • Gradual cold exposure
    • Meditation and mental focus

Although these approaches differ substantially, they share one common goal:

Triggering adaptive stress responses that may improve resilience.


How Might Cold Exposure Help?

Researchers believe cold exposure influences several biological systems.

1. Reduced Chronic Inflammation

Chronic inflammation contributes to:

  • Cancer progression
  • Cardiovascular disease
  • Diabetes
  • Obesity
  • Depression
  • Aging

A 2025 meta-analysis of 11 randomized controlled trials found that whole-body cryotherapy reduced inflammatory markers, including IL-1β, while increasing the anti-inflammatory IL-10. These effects appeared strongest in athletes and individuals with obesity.

This is encouraging because inflammation is one of the major biological processes associated with both cancer recurrence and long-term survivorship issues.


2. Improved Stress Response

Cold exposure activates the sympathetic nervous system.

This causes temporary increases in:

  • Norepinephrine
  • Epinephrine (adrenaline)
  • Dopamine

Researchers believe these hormones may explain why many people report:

  • Better mood
  • Increased alertness
  • Greater energy
  • Improved resilience to stress

The Wim Hof Method appears to amplify these responses through controlled breathing combined with cold exposure. A recent systematic review concluded that the method shows promising anti-inflammatory effects, although larger studies are still needed.


3. Possible Immune Modulation

One of the most fascinating studies on the Wim Hof Method showed that trained participants could voluntarily influence part of their immune response.

Compared with controls, participants demonstrated:

  • Higher epinephrine
  • More IL-10
  • Lower pro-inflammatory cytokines after experimental endotoxin exposure

This does not mean people can “control” their immune system at will.

It does suggest that breathing plus cold exposure may influence immune regulation in measurable ways.


4. Exercise Recovery

Athletes have long used cold therapy.

Evidence suggests it may:

  • Reduce soreness
  • Decrease inflammation
  • Speed recovery after intense exercise

However, timing matters.

Several sports medicine studies suggest that frequent cold immersion immediately after resistance training may blunt muscle growth adaptations. If building strength is your goal, waiting several hours after lifting may be preferable.

For cancer survivors focused on walking, aerobic exercise, or managing fatigue, this concern is usually less important.


What About Cancer?

This is where we need to be careful.

At present:

There is no evidence that cold plunges, cryotherapy, or the Wim Hof Method treat cancer.

None.

However, researchers are beginning to ask more interesting questions.

Because cold exposure appears to influence:

  • inflammation
  • immune signaling
  • metabolism
  • brown fat activation

Scientists are investigating whether these changes could someday complement conventional cancer therapy.

At this point, that research remains preliminary.

Cold exposure should be viewed as a supportive lifestyle intervention—not a cancer treatment.


Could Cold Exposure Help Cancer Survivors?

Potential benefits include:

Reduced fatigue

Many survivors report feeling energized after cold showers or brief cold plunges.

Clinical evidence is still limited, but improved alertness makes biological sense given increases in norepinephrine.


Better mood

Cold exposure stimulates neurotransmitters associated with:

  • motivation
  • attention
  • mood

Small studies suggest improvements in perceived well-being, although larger trials are needed.


Reduced inflammation

Persistent inflammation contributes to many late effects of cancer therapy, including:

  • fatigue
  • cardiovascular disease
  • frailty

If cold exposure safely lowers inflammatory markers, this could become increasingly relevant for survivorship.


Recovery from exercise

Cancer rehabilitation programs increasingly emphasize exercise.

Cold therapy may help reduce soreness and encourage continued activity for some survivors.


What About Whole-Body Cryotherapy?

Whole-body cryotherapy (WBC) involves standing in an extremely cold chamber for about 2–3 minutes.

Current research suggests WBC may:

  • lower inflammatory cytokines
  • improve recovery
  • reduce soreness
  • improve subjective well-being

The evidence is promising but still relatively small, and standardized treatment protocols are lacking.


Is the Wim Hof Method Different?

Yes.

The Wim Hof Method combines:

  • breathing exercises
  • gradual cold exposure
  • mindfulness

Researchers increasingly believe the breathing component contributes significantly to its physiological effects.

A 2024 systematic review concluded:

  • anti-inflammatory effects appear promising
  • exercise performance benefits remain inconsistent
  • larger, better-designed clinical trials are needed

Who Should NOT Practice Cold Exposure?

Cold exposure is not appropriate for everyone.

Talk with your physician before trying it if you have:

  • heart disease
  • uncontrolled hypertension
  • arrhythmias
  • Raynaud’s syndrome
  • severe peripheral vascular disease
  • uncontrolled asthma
  • significant neuropathy
  • advanced frailty

Cancer survivors receiving active chemotherapy or immunotherapy should also discuss cold exposure with their oncology team.


A Critical Safety Warning About Wim Hof Breathing

This point deserves emphasis.

Never perform Wim Hof breathing while:

  • swimming
  • driving
  • in a bathtub
  • underwater
  • operating machinery

The breathing technique can cause lightheadedness or loss of consciousness. There have been reported drownings associated with practicing breath-holding in or near water.

Always practice seated or lying down in a safe environment.


Practical Recommendations

If you’re interested in trying cold exposure:

Start slowly.

For most people:

  • Finish your shower with 30–60 seconds of cool water.
  • Gradually increase exposure over several weeks.
  • Focus on controlled breathing rather than enduring pain.
  • Stop immediately if you experience dizziness, chest pain, or severe discomfort.
  • View cold exposure as one component of an overall healthy lifestyle—not a substitute for evidence-based cancer treatment.

My Perspective

PeopleBeatingCancer has always emphasized therapies that are:

  • evidence-based
  • low toxicity
  • affordable
  • compatible with conventional oncology

Cold exposure appears to fit that philosophy—with appropriate caution.

The evidence suggests it may reduce inflammation, improve stress resilience, and enhance recovery.

What it does not show is that cold exposure treats cancer.

If future clinical trials confirm benefits for cancer survivors, cold therapy may become another useful tool alongside exercise, sleep, nutrition, stress management, and selected evidence-based supplements.

Until then, it’s best viewed as a potentially helpful lifestyle practice—not a miracle therapy.


Key Takeaways

  • Cold exposure may reduce inflammation.
  • Whole-body cryotherapy has encouraging—but still limited—clinical evidence.
  • The Wim Hof Method appears capable of influencing stress and immune responses.
  • There is no evidence that cold exposure cures or treats cancer.
  • Cancer survivors should discuss cold therapy with their healthcare team, particularly if they have cardiovascular disease or are receiving active treatment.
  • Like exercise and nutrition, cold exposure may eventually become one more evidence-based tool for improving survivorship.
